Video game publisher Square Enix is announcing that the Witch Chapter 0 tech demo, which has previously been used to show off the power of its new Luminous engine, is now optimized to run on the new DirectX 12 tech from Microsoft.

The company says that it has worked with the creator of the API and with a team at Nvidia in order to develop better than ever real-time computer graphics technology that will allow future titles to offer a better experience.

Witch Chapter 0 focuses on crying, one of the emotions that has been very hard to portray realistically using existing tech.

The footage is pretty impressive, but it's unlikely that actual gameplay will ever become as complex as the demo.

The tech demo was created by the same team that worked on the Agni's Philosophy - Final Fantasy Realtime Tech Demo, which was first introduced in June 2012.

Yosuke Matsuda, the president and representative director of Square Enix, states, "The results will be used to further advance the quality and technical expertise of our games. We will continue to pursue this research on cutting-edge technologies including high-end real-time graphics using the innovative DirectX 12."

Witch Chapter 0 was shown at the most recent BUILD Microsoft event using a setup that included the Nvidia GeForce GTX Titan X-4-way SLI PC.

DirectX 12 will significantly improve gaming on both the PC and the Xbox One

At the moment, the new API is set to be launched later in the year alongside the new Windows 10 operating system.

Microsoft is saying that the included technology will be able to improve both the quality of graphics and the actual performance of titles on the PC and on the Xbox One home console.

DirectX 12 will be used by the team working on the new Final Fantasy titles at Square Enix.

Microsoft also says that, with the launch of Windows 10 and the addition of the new graphics tech, it will bring gaming on the PC and the Xbox One closer and will allow players to have a better overall experience on both platforms.
